**Your Opportunity**

Reporting into the Partners and Associate Directors your role will sit within KPMG’s ESG & Responsible Investment (RI) team, supporting the ESG & RI team in delivering on ESG, climate change and other responsible investment projects for clients. Clients will include superfunds, investment managers, banks and insurers who are either mature or nascent in their ESG/Sustainability journey.

The role will focus on the following:

- Leveraging client information, and ESG data providers to produce annual ESG assessment reports for a range of clients to track progress and identify areas for improvement.
- Facilitate ESG education sessions and workshops for Boards and employees, RI policy and procedure drafting, ESG reporting framework development and the integration of ESG in client portfolios.
- Support the delivery of new services such as stewardship advisory services.
- Support and lead the delivery of ESG due diligence services for potential assets and acquisitions.
- Utilise KPMG’s climate risk tools to assess client portfolios for climate risk and identify possible investment solutions to establish more sustainable, resilient portfolios.
- Support the delivery of ESG assurance services, such as ISSB, PCAF, UN PRI Reporting and ESG/RI statements in Sustainability and Annual reports.
- Contribute to KPMG’ RI intellectual capital and Thought Leadership: working with the global RI team, the role, will also have opportunity to contribute to development of new intellectual capital and solutions.

**Your Experience**

Preferable experience will include roles within superfund, bank or asset manager either in ESG role or with experience working with the ESG role or withing a consulting firm with direct experience in ESG. Other experiences may include:

- Knowledge of, and experience with different asset classes of investment managers (listed equity, private equity fixed income, real estate, infrastructure, hedge fund).
- Familiarity, and experience with sustainable finance products (e.g. green loans, green bonds, sustainability linked loans)
- Knowledge of and experience with international sustainability and assurance guidelines and standards such as the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s), UN Principles for Responsible Investment (UNPRI), Task Force on Climate Related Financial Disclosures (TCFD), Global Real Estate Sustainability Benchmarks (GRESB), Sustainability Accounting Standards Board (SASB), National Greenhouse and Energy Reporting (NGER) Scheme, Emissions Reduction Fund (ERF) and Carbon Disclosure Project (CDP)
- Ability to conduct technical and high-quality analysis of ESG processes, investment principles and strategies, including benchmarking organisational performance.

**Qualifications**:

- Qualifications at a Degree level in an appropriate discipline such as sustainability, climate change, finance, economics, commerce, law and corporate governance. A suitable post graduate qualification in a relevant discipline is preferred.
